About our group
We are a fabulous, friendly running group based in Bingley.
We meet on a Monday and Thursday at 6:30pm opposite Bingley Pool on Myrtle Grove, Bingley.
We also hold extra sessions to challenge you such as hill training sessions, speed sessions and longer distance sessions.
We have runners of ALL abilities who run with us, so please don't ever think you are too slow to join the group.
If you are an absolute beginner, then look out for our Couch to 5K sessions - we will announce the start of each new beginners group on social media.
All of our run leaders are full UKA qualified and DBS checked.
We have 3 running groups which allows you to choose the group that fits your needs and also allows you to flex between groups if you are preparing for a race or wanting a different paced run.
Steady Eddies - This is a group for those new to running or those wanting a more socia and chatty paced run. The pace as a guide is 5km in 40-50mins
Movers and Shakers - This is a group for those wanting a quicker pace or longer run and will normally run between 5 and 7km on each session - The pace as a guide is 5km in 30-40mins
Speedy Stampede - This group is for those looking to run at a much quicker pace and for a longer distance. We normally run between 6 and 8km - The pace as a quide is 5km in 25-30mins
All groups are open to everyone and we never leave anyone behind. We use a looping method which keeps the group together whilst allowing for different paces within the group.
Every session is free to join, in return, all we ask if that you support everyone around you in the group and bring the occasional cake :)
